Silent Hill has been experiencing a revitalization phase, with external studios bringing fresh perspectives to the franchise. Konami has allowed talented developers like Bloober Team and NeoBards to work on new entries, such as the recently revealed Silent Hill: Townfall. This upcoming title aims to capture the essence of Silent Hill's horror with a first-person thriller approach.

Townfall is set in the port town of St. Amelia in Scotland, developed by Screen Burn, formerly known as No Code. Drawing inspiration from real-world locations, the game immerses players in a fog-covered environment where they control Simon Ordell. The gameplay heavily focuses on stealth and puzzle-solving, reminiscent of Alien Isolation, offering a unique and atmospheric experience.

Players will utilize a handheld radio device, CRTV, to navigate the town, solve puzzles, and evade enemies. The diegetic gameplay mechanic enhances immersion by requiring players to pay close attention to visual signals on the device. Townfall's narrative revolves around Simon investigating the abandoned St. Amelia, uncovering mysteries through exploration and interaction with characters like nurse Zoe Ellis.
